What are the Sunshine State Standards?

0

The Sunshine State Standards provide expectations for student achievement in Florida schools and are available from the http://www.firn.edu/doe/menu/sss.htm link. STEPS, the Lesson Architect, software was developed at UWF to help teachers incorporate the Sunshine State Standards into their lesson planning process (see: http://www.ibinder.uwf.edu/steps/). STEPS and PLANright (http://www.ibinder.uwf.edu/planright/) are part of the iBinder system (see: http://www.ibinder.uwf.edu/ibpage.cfm?id=1). The Sunshine State Standards are tested through the FCAT.
